Signs You Need to Replace Your Garage Door Drums
Are you noticing any signs of worn out garage door drums? Are you hearing or seeing things that don’t sound right? Here are the most common signs that require repairing or replacing your drums:
1.Visual Signs of a Failing Garage Door Drum
- Uneven or tilted door movement – If the door lurches, tilts to one side, or appears higher on one side during operation, it often indicates imbalanced drums.
- Worn, frayed, or slipping cables – Cables that sag, jump off the drums, or show fraying are clear signs of wear or misalignment.
- Visible damage on drums – Cracks, rust, warping, or worn grooves on the drums signal the need for inspection or replacement.
2.Audible Signs of a Failing Garage Door Drum
- Grinding or squeaking noises – Persistent grinding, squeaking, or groaning during door movement often points to worn or damaged drums.
- Banging, rattling, or loud bangs – Sudden loud noises such as banging or rattling can signal drum failure or a loss of cable tension.
What Are the Risks of Failing Garage Door Drums?
The most dangerous risks of failing garage door drums include:
- Sudden door collapse – A broken drum can cause the heavy garage door (often 200–500 lbs) to slip, fall, or lose support, potentially crushing people, pets, or vehicles beneath it. This poses a high risk of severe injury or even fatality, especially in high-traffic areas.
- Personal injury from system failure – Faulty drums can lead to cable fraying, snapping, or slippage, resulting in violent recoils or misaligned operation. These failures may cause lacerations, fractures, or impacts during use or DIY repairs. Torsion spring tension often worsens the danger, making this one of the leading causes of garage door accidents.
- Property and further damage – Drum failure places strain on tracks, openers, and springs, increasing the risk of vehicle dents, structural garage damage, or total system breakdown—driving up both repair costs and safety hazards.
